Comprehending the Types of Driving Licenses in the UK
Before diving into the procedure of acquiring a driving license online, it's important to comprehend the types of licenses available in the UK:

Provisional Driving License: This is the primary step for new drivers. A provisionary license permits people to learn to drive under supervision and works after an application has been authorized.

Complete Driving License: After passing the driving test, a provisional license can be transformed into a complete driving license, permitting individuals to drive separately.

Special Licenses: These include licenses for particular automobile categories such as motorbikes, buses, and trucks.

The procedure of getting a UK driving license online is uncomplicated. Here's a step-by-step guide:
Step 1: Prepare Required Documents
Before beginning the application, collect the essential files, including:
Your present passport or an alternative kind of identity.Your National Insurance number.Your address history for the previous three years.Any medical details that might matter.Action 2: Visit the Official DVLA Website
The Driver and Vehicle Licensing Agency (DVLA) is the official government body accountable for driver licensing in the UK. Candidates must always begin at the DVLA's official site to ensure they are accessing genuine services.
Step 3: Complete the Online Application
Once on the DVLA site, select the choice to look for a driving license. Complete the online type with accurate details referring to your identity, address, and any additional questions.
Step 4: Pay the Application Fee
An application cost is required to process your license request. Payments can be made online via debit or charge card. As of the current guidelines, the charge for a provisionary license is typically around ₤ 34.
Step 5: Submit Your Application
After completing the type and making the payment, review all information for accuracy, then submit your application.
Step 6: Wait for Your License
When submitted, the DVLA will process your application. For provisional licenses, processing generally takes about 3 weeks. Complete driving licenses may take longer, especially if dry runs are involved.
